Imaginary Numbers Are Real (Part 9: Closure)

Curated and Reviewed by Lesson Planet

The last video in a series about imaginary numbers demonstrates the need for complex numbers. Math pupils learn that they need to include the square root of negative one, the building block of the complex numbers, to have a set of numbers that are closed under all operations.
